計算機系統(tǒng)是現(xiàn)代信息技術(shù)的核心,其高效運行依賴于硬件組成與操作系統(tǒng)的協(xié)同工作。本文將從計算機組成和操作系統(tǒng)兩個維度,簡要介紹它們?nèi)绾喂餐峁┫到y(tǒng)服務(wù)。
一、計算機組成基礎(chǔ)
計算機組成涉及硬件架構(gòu),主要包括五大部件:運算器、控制器、存儲器、輸入設(shè)備和輸出設(shè)備。這些部件通過總線相互連接,協(xié)同執(zhí)行指令。例如,中央處理器(CPU)作為計算機的“大腦”,集成了運算器和控制器,負責(zé)數(shù)據(jù)處理和指令控制;內(nèi)存(RAM)用于臨時存儲運行中的程序和數(shù)據(jù);硬盤等外部存儲器則提供持久化存儲。這些硬件組件共同構(gòu)成了計算機的物理基礎(chǔ),為系統(tǒng)服務(wù)提供物質(zhì)支持。
二、操作系統(tǒng)核心功能
操作系統(tǒng)是管理計算機硬件與軟件資源的系統(tǒng)軟件,充當(dāng)用戶與硬件之間的橋梁。其主要功能包括進程管理、內(nèi)存管理、文件系統(tǒng)和設(shè)備驅(qū)動。例如,進程管理負責(zé)調(diào)度多個任務(wù),確保CPU資源合理分配;內(nèi)存管理通過虛擬內(nèi)存技術(shù)擴展可用空間;文件系統(tǒng)組織數(shù)據(jù)存儲,而設(shè)備驅(qū)動則協(xié)調(diào)外部設(shè)備操作。操作系統(tǒng)通過抽象硬件細節(jié),為用戶和應(yīng)用程序提供統(tǒng)一、便捷的接口。
三、系統(tǒng)服務(wù)的協(xié)同實現(xiàn)
計算機組成和操作系統(tǒng)共同實現(xiàn)系統(tǒng)服務(wù),如計算、存儲和通信。硬件提供底層能力,而操作系統(tǒng)通過資源管理和調(diào)度優(yōu)化這些服務(wù)。例如,當(dāng)用戶運行一個程序時,CPU執(zhí)行指令,內(nèi)存加載數(shù)據(jù),操作系統(tǒng)則管理進程優(yōu)先級和內(nèi)存分配,確保服務(wù)高效、穩(wěn)定。這種協(xié)同不僅提升了性能,還增強了系統(tǒng)的安全性和可靠性。
理解計算機組成和操作系統(tǒng)的關(guān)系,有助于優(yōu)化系統(tǒng)設(shè)計,推動技術(shù)創(chuàng)新。隨著云計算和物聯(lián)網(wǎng)的發(fā)展,這一基礎(chǔ)知識將更加重要。
如若轉(zhuǎn)載,請注明出處:http://www.thinkofdesign.cn/product/29.html
更新時間:2026-04-14 19:00:10
PRODUCT